Carson Paradis is a Canadian American photographer and visual storyteller exploring the intersection of art, science, and social issues. Blending a foundation in human physiology with documentary practice, he brings a research-driven approach to visual storytelling.
His work spans photojournalism, concert photography, and mixed-media projects, often drawing from natural and human landscapes to reveal deeper narratives.
Paradis is currently developing a documentary project on the Po River in northern Italy, highlighting the impacts of climate change, drought, and deluge on local communities and ecosystems.
